Output 8d5f1541aa6ee865255fe40ec79b591f4a0b05cf839c180bee6284bcb474b57e:0

value
104340820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08ce2ba8cb45bd7b886ae4d8f3aeb2c36b1b925a OP_EQUAL
address
M8hicwnXpkuLcMUccvvR1xiZP28fxC36YY
transaction
8d5f1541aa6ee865255fe40ec79b591f4a0b05cf839c180bee6284bcb474b57e
spent
true